UPDATED: Slate Valley school spending fails for 3rd time

Orwell Village School is one of seven schools in the Slate Valley district, which on Thursday defeated its third budget proposal.

The absence of an approved FY’25 spending plan pushes SVUUSD closer to the prospect of having to borrow funds to at least begin the next budget cycle, which begins July 1.
